The device uses the buttons on your steering wheel or dashboard to generate an unique and reversible PIN code that must be entered prior to driving the vehicle. The code can contain up to 20 digits, and if you need to reset your PIN or forget it, you can use an encrypted code that only you are aware of. It does not emit radio frequencies or LED indicators and is undetectable to thieves.

The system is silently connected to the onboard CAN data network, and can only be deactivated using the correct pin code configuration. Installations with low impact

Ghost makes use of the original buttons to communicate with the ECU unit, instead of cutting and running wires. This means that there is no need for drilling or wiring any car parts. This reduces the chance of damage to your car and makes the installation process more cost-effective.
